Egress/Easy Clean Hinge

They are an excellent choice for replacing or upgrading windows for fire escapes because they open at a full 90-degree angle. They can also be disengaged to an 'easy clean' position to allow you to easily access the exterior of windows to clean them without having to climb an overhang or climb a ladder at potentially hazardous angles.

Yale is among the most trusted and well-known brands in the world of home security. These hinges can be used with any type of uPVC side hung window. They can be moved to the easy-to-clean position by pressing an unassuming button, and then sliding the window sash to one side. When the window is closed, the sash will return to its original position.

They are available in both 13mm and 17mm stack heights. Make use of our Egress Selection Guide to help you select the best product for your window.

The hinges are designed to work with standard side-hung frames which is made of aluminum or uPVC. They come with an easy friction screw that can adjust the amount of resistance that is generated. This makes it easier to open the window and reduces the risk of an accidental closure in severe winds. They have been tested to more than 30000 cycles and are in compliance with BBA/Secured by Design and British Standards approved BS EN 13126-6:2008.

Without buttons or catches, the Nico Egress Easy Clean Friction Hinge is simple to use and provides a simple solution for emergency egress and safe cleaning. Press the hinge retention clip located on the inside of the bottom corner. This will open both the top and bottom catches allowing you move the sash towards the clean position. Close the window once you have the sash in an easy-cleaning position. This will set the hinges back to their Egress positions.

Fire-Escape Hinge

Fire Escape Hinges (also known as "Easy Clean") are used to replace windows that open sideways to ensure fire safety. These kinds of hinges for windows are more spacious and more efficient than conventional hinges to provide an expansive clear opening to escape in the case of a fire. This type of hinge is legal in any living space with a window as required by building regulations.

They feature an exclusive friction stopper that opens the window to an angle of 90 degrees. It also allows the opening sash to slide across when it is open for easy cleaning of the external side of the glass without needing to use ladders. The hinges are simple to operate and don't have complicated buttons or catches. They can be operated from inside of the house with a safe, simple lever.

The hinges, which are manufactured in the UK by Cotswold and Cotswold, have a child safety feature for daily use. This can be removed with an invisible button. You'll be able to rest of mind knowing that your children won't accidentally open the windows too wide. They are available in 13mm and 17mm stack heights.

Take a measurement of the length of the side-hung window hinge that is fixed to the frame. (See the guide for measuring the length of upvc window hinges). Choose the right size hinge below.

Be aware that the measurement is taken from the part that fixes to the frame not the sash, the actual hinge length may be slightly shorter or longer based on the manufacture of your old windows. Also, when choosing the width of your hinge most windows made of upvc will have 13mm stack height, however should your window frame is 17mm wide, you should select the option to use this. You can also use the 4mm packer in order to make up for the difference. All hinges are in two different directions (1 left and one right). The hinges do not include screws. These can be bought separately if required. We recommend using our Upvc window hinge repair screws. These screws are designed to increase your hinges' performance and allow them to work smoothly for longer. They have a reduced-friction design and a heightened weather seal that includes an encapsulated nylon reducer cap.

Restricted Hinge

There are occasions windows need to fully open and this can be a challenge with hinges that are standard. The restricted child safety friction hinges can help overcome this issue and provide a solution when ventilation is required but access to clean up or escape in the case of fire isn't possible. They limit the number of times you can opening the sash and allow overriding this limitation by pressing an appropriate button. They are suitable for both side and top-hung windows. They are available in 17mm and 13mm stack heights.

The Nico Restricted Egress Friction hinge combines the advantages of a standard restrictor as well as an escape hinge to provide an efficient and simple method to meet building regulations. It is suitable for side-hung and top opening uPVC windows and is available in 13mm and 17mm stack heights. It is supplied in a pair, where one hinge is restricted egress and the second is unrestricted, allowing one hinge to be installed at the bottom of the sash whilst the other is attached to the top.

These uPVC restricting hinges have been tested to BS6375 Part 2 and are designed for use on a window that isn't able to be fully opened, like a small children's bedroom. The mechanism limits how far the sash opens up to a safe position of 100mm and then it re-engages after the window is closed.

As with the other types of uPVC friction hinges that are available, these hinges can be used on any type of window and are perfect for difficult to access windows above the ground three-storey flats, or windows that normally require a ladder to reach them. They can be combined with our range of security enhancements such as hinge guard protection plates or dog bolts to provide PAS 24 performance.
